In the last couple of days I finally could do something just to chill out, play and make my hands busy.  I have to admit I love creating like this: starting with a white page, choosing a photo and adding the elements which are somewhere nearby... old tickets, lace, thread, coin, tapes...


This way I keep filling my "Family Odyssey Journal" with new pages - it is not only a way to relax but my contemplation, making connections with my loved ones again - no matter how far from each other we are now. This page is about my grandma, Helena.The photo was taken outside her apartment block in Warsaw about 20 years ago. I loved visiting her and my grandpa - they loved us so much!



Most of the color comes from homemade tea stain, but there is more: some Gelatos, Watercolour Pencils, Archival Ink. You don't need much to express your feelings!
